5 days to Hawaii

Saw the ps on 1/24 got a good report, but still not standing straight. He said I should be by now. Mostly cuz I'm not walking everyday, but it's so darn cold. And now we have this "ice" storm that hit lower Alabama. Thankfully it is to melt today. I work on standing straight but my stomach is so tight and I night my stomach feels irritated like a really bad sunburn and standing straight only seems to make it worse, but I'm improving. I will be able to stand straight for pictures! Been wearing a cg, but I swear a man designed it. The hooks in the crotch and barely be reached to hook and unhook and the thigh areas have excess material that while it looks good, it does not function well. Ends up bunched up in my groin cutting off circulation like a twisted pair of support hose. Doc said I would not have to wear 24/7 while in Hawaii, so I'm going to wear something a little more light weight. If I start to swell then I will go back to the torture garment, I mean compression garment ;) I'm not posting any pics cuz I really haven't changed much. Sleeping is some better, still can't sleep on my side well. Right hip still hurts to lay on and thighs are still tender. I guess its just the nerves. I can lay some on my left side but not for long periods. Still use pillows under my knees. I tried to decrease on that, but made my back hurt so bad I couldn't sleep. I have a whole piece swim suit on order for trip since I have to keep bb covered. I do have a two piece, but will have to wear a cover up. Will try to post swim suit pics when I get to Hawaii :) My abdomen is still tender to press on, but I am beginning to feel softer.
